Understanding Nylon 6 Industrial Yarn: Versatility and Applications

2025-04-02


Nylon 6 industrial yarn is a synthetic fiber that has gained popularity in a wide range of textile applications due to its unique properties and versatility. Produced through the polymerization of caprolactam, Nylon 6 is known for its excellent strength, elasticity, and durability, making it an ideal choice for various industrial uses.
One of the standout features of Nylon 6 industrial yarn is its remarkable tensile strength. This characteristic allows it to endure heavy loads and resist wear and tear, which is essential for applications such as ropes, nets, and other heavy-duty textile products. Additionally, Nylon 6 exhibits excellent resilience, allowing it to maintain its shape even after repeated stress, a crucial aspect for items that require longevity and reliability.
Another significant advantage of Nylon 6 is its resistance to abrasion. This property makes it suitable for use in environments where friction is common, ensuring that the yarn maintains its integrity over time. Furthermore, Nylon 6 is resistant to many chemicals, which broadens its applicability in industrial settings where exposure to harsh substances may occur.
In terms of versatility, Nylon 6 industrial yarn can be produced in various denier sizes, allowing manufacturers to tailor the yarn to meet specific requirements. The fine denier yarns are particularly popular in applications such as upholstery, while thicker denier yarns are favored for heavy-duty uses. This adaptability makes it a preferred choice for many textile manufacturers looking to create high-quality products.
Nylon 6 also has excellent dyeing properties, enabling manufacturers to produce vibrant and long-lasting colors. This attribute is particularly beneficial in fashion and design, where aesthetics play a vital role in product appeal. The ability to achieve consistent color quality makes Nylon 6 an attractive option for designers aiming for high standards in textile production.
Moreover, the moisture-wicking properties of Nylon 6 contribute to its suitability in activewear and outdoor products. It effectively transports moisture away from the body, helping to keep users dry and comfortable during physical activities. This feature has made it a popular choice in the sportswear industry, where performance and comfort are paramount.
In summary, Nylon 6 industrial yarn is a powerful material in the textile industry, known for its strength, durability, and versatility. Its multiple applications, from heavy-duty textiles to fashionable garments, highlight its importance in modern textile manufacturing processes.
